Requirements

Additional Requirements

This Scholarship programme is funded by UCD Michael Smurfit Graduate Business School. The scholarships are awarded to academically exceptional students from Vietnam.

The Scholarship programme aims to attract excellent candidates to the Schools MSc programmes and encourage early application. Successful candidates will be ambassadors for their course and the School during their studies and after graduation.

Scholarship awards cover up to 50% of the tuition fees per candidate.

Scholarships are open to self-sponsored candidates who have been offered a place on a full time MSc Programme. Applicants must have completed the application process to the programme of their choice and fulfilled the necessary admissions requirements.

Scholarship winners will be selected on merit.

Please note that UCD Belfield programmes run in conjunction with UCD Smurfit School - MSc in Biotechnology and Business, MSc in Biotherapeutics and Business and MSc in International Law and Business - are not eligible for Scholarships.

How to Apply

1. Complete your UCD Smurfit online application for the MSc Programme you wish to get a place on. Click here to apply for a UCD Smurfit Taught Masters.

2. All applicants will automatically be considered for this Scholarship so there is no separate form or process for this scholarship.

To be considered you must have a minimum IELTS score of 7.0 or a TOEFL of 100 / 120 for our English Language Requirement and you also must have a degree result average of minimum 8 out of 10 (i.e. minimum 80% average). You also must hold a full unconditional offer from the UCD Smurfit School of Business.

Decisions will be made by the Schools Scholarship Committee. All decisions are final. Successful candidates can be awarded one Scholarship only. No candidate will be awarded more than one Scholarship or Bursary. Candidates qualifying for more than one scholarship and successful can't transfer or use one scholarship between or against another programme.
